Penn Women, RowAmerica Rye Juniors Win Big at Head of the Schuylkill

The University of Pennsylvania women finished first and second in five events at the Head of the Schuylkill Regatta, October 25-26, in Philadelphia.

“PWC enjoyed another exceptional Head of the Schuylkill Regatta,” said Bill Manning, Penn’s head coach. “The City of Philadelphia, the Philadelphia rowing community and Boathouse Row, our alumnae, and the weather all turned out to make a great day.”

RowAmerica Rye racked up 11 wins, including the men’s high school trainer singles (JV), men’s high school quads (frosh/novice), men’s high school fours with cox (varsity), women’s high school fours with cox (varsity), The Michael O’Gorman women’s high school eights (frosh/novice), The Paul Coomes women’s high school quads (varsity) women’s high school quads (JV), women’s high school fours with cox (JV), men’s high school fours with cox (frosh/novice), women’s high school eights (varsity/first boats), and women’s high school eights (JV and lower boats).

St. Joseph’s Prep won the men’s high school eights (varsity/first boats), The Michael O’Gorman men’s high school eights (frosh/novice) and men’s high school fours with cox (JV).

Mirroring national trends in tourism, in which Canadian visits to the U.S. by car fell 35 percent in September, Canadian entries in this year’s regatta were down 22 percent (138 crews, from 175 in 2024). Still, St. Catharines Rowing Club brought a formidable armada of sculling boats, winning the men’s high school coxed quads varsity and JV events, as well as the men’s high school doubles (JV).

Potomac’s Michael “Tony” Madigan scored an eight-second victory against his friendly rival, CRI’s Simeon John, who won the Head of the Charles by seven seconds over Madigan the prior weekend, re-setting his own course record. Madigan is the defending youth national champion and finished fifth at the 2025 World Rowing Under-19 Championships. Both have won multiple Canadian Henley golds and have developed a healthy rivalry and could be the future of American sculling on the elite level.
